To answer your questions:
1) I live in Arlington and have jogged through the GWU area many times. The sorority townhouses look really cute, but I'm not sure they can house a lot of members.

You could see if you can board in a sorority house. Contact GWU about that policy.

Even if you do board in the sorority house, you would still have to go through rush.

FYI- boarding in sorority house XYZ does not automatically give you a bid to XYZ.You will still have to attend their rush events.

2) Epsilon Sigma Alpha, a national service sorority, has a chapter at GW. That's another option.

3)DC has good night life. Georgetown has great restaurants and bars. Dupont Circle is a nice walk from Foggy Bottom, also lots of fun. I haven't been to Adams Morgan or U St/Cardozo in years, but those areas used to be lots of fun. If you like punk or indie music, you can go to the Black Cat on U St. (U St was dangerous, so I didn't go that often.) Arlington, VA is a short metro ride from GW's campus. We have loads of restaurants and two music venues, Iota and Galaxy Hut.
